CROWN Cork & Seal USA, Inc., a wholly owned company of Crown Holdings, Inc., is a global leader in the design, manufacture, and sale of packaging products for consumer goods. At Crown, we are passionate about helping our customers build their brands and connect with consumers around the world. We do this by delivering innovative packaging that offers significant value for brand owners, retailers, and consumers alike.
With operations in 39 countries, employing approximately 25,000 people and net sales of approximately $12 billion, we bring best practices in quality and manufacturing to our customers to drive their businesses locally and globally.

Position OverviewThe Manufacturing Supervisor works closely with the Plant Manager and Plant Superintendent to ensure the production of a quality product that meets or exceeds customer expectations.
Duties and Responsibilities- Coordinates and supervises activities of equipment and personnel throughout the facility with a focus on optimizing safety, quality, productivity and spoilage.
- Communicates all pertinent information between departments and shifts regarding equipment changes, production schedules, production problems or any other related information.
- Works with employees to identify, discuss solutions and implement “fixes” on machinery and equipment problems.
- Performs and facilitates “on‑the‑job training” and/or coaching of all employees as needed or required.
- Applies knowledge of various processes, production methods and processes to improve plant production.
- Manages machinery set-up and adjustment and inspects products to ensure compliance to standards.
- Oversees quality and recommends modifications of existing quality or production standards to achieve optimal performance within the equipment limits.
- Completes and/or administers necessary documentation such as production sheets, pallet ticketing, job progressions, disciplinary actions, monthly SAFE cards, time and attendance, accident reports and process control sheets.
- Performs other job‑related duties as required or assigned.
